rust_ocpp/v2_0_1/messages/
cleared_charging_limit.rs1use crate::v2_0_1::enumerations::charging_limit_source_enum_type::ChargingLimitSourceEnumType;
3
4#[derive(serde::Serialize, serde::Deserialize, Debug, Clone, PartialEq, Default)]
6#[serde(rename_all = "camelCase")]
7pub struct ClearedChargingLimitRequest {
8 pub charging_limit_source: ChargingLimitSourceEnumType,
10 #[serde(skip_serializing_if = "Option::is_none")]
12 pub evse_id: Option<i32>,
13}
14
15#[derive(serde::Serialize, serde::Deserialize, Debug, Clone, PartialEq, Default)]
17#[serde(rename_all = "camelCase")]
18pub struct ClearedChargingLimitResponse {
19 }